Whisky review: Glen Garioch Virgin Oak (NAS) bottled @ 48%

Whisky review: Glen Garioch Virgin Oak (NAS) bottled @ 48%

-3rd Glen Garioch if I'm not mistaken
-Virgin oak
-bottled above 40%
-American White Oak matured
-Non chill-filtered

Colour: Golden with red hints

Nose: wood sap (as one would expect from ''virgin oak''), acidic notes, apples, fruit juice.

Mouth: spices, wood sap, fresh cut wood, apples, bitter notes, yet light.

Finish: acidic notes, sap and some distant apples.

D for the price. 127$ for a NAS? really? I would not purchase this Glen Garioch. I would rebuy the Founder's reserve instead.
B+ for presentation. Same bottling with more fancy colours on it.
C+ for the taste. It's a good whisky but just ok in terms of Virgin Oak. The Deanston remains on of the best at a much better price point.
